Einzelnen Beitrag anzeigen

Hedge

Registriert seit: 30. Jun 2007
278 Beiträge
 
Delphi 2009 Professional
 
#1

Für jedes Fenster eigenen Taskbareintrag (Windows 7)

  Alt 30. Okt 2009, 12:02
Habe eine Applikation mit 2 Forms und möchte für beide einen einzelnen Taskbareintrag haben.

Dazu habe ich mehrere Sachen gefunden, aber keine funktioniert.

Erstmal:

Delphi-Quellcode:
type
  TForm1 = class(TForm)
    dwJumpLists1: TdwJumpLists;
    procedure FormShow(Sender: TObject);
    procedure FormCreate(Sender: TObject);
  protected
      procedure CreateParams(var Params: TCreateParams);
  end;
danach dann:

Delphi-Quellcode:
procedure TForm1.CreateParams
   (var Params: TCreateParams);
begin
  inherited;
  Params.ExStyle := Params.ExStyle or WS_EX_APPWINDOW;
end;
oder:

Delphi-Quellcode:
procedure TForm1.CreateParams(var Params : TCreateParams);
begin
  inherited CreateParams(Params);
  Params.WndParent := GetDesktopWindow;
  Params.Caption:='Title';
end;
٩๏̯͡๏)۶
  Mit Zitat antworten Zitat